We end our season with a powerful adaptation of Steinbeck's classic novella by the father of American opera, Carlisle Floyd. Of Mice and Men delves deep into the American psyche and experience of the 1930s and brings to life the unbreakable bond between George and Lennie, migrant farm workers, striving for the American Dream. Directed by Kristine McIntyre, our production uses projections to immerse the audience in Lennie's perspective, blending intimate humanity with cinematic scope in a gripping, tragic journey.

This brand-new production is co-produced by Lyric Opera of Kansas City, Houston Grand Opera, Florida State University, and Des Moines Metro Opera.

Content advisory: Of Mice and Men contains gunshots and depictions of violence, murder, and animal cruelty.
